The motion picture, also known as pacific northwest ballet s nutcracker or simply nutcracker, is a 1986 american christmas performing arts film produced by pacific northwest ballet in association with hyperion pictures and kushnerlocke, and released theatrically by atlantic releasing corporation. The national ballet of canada, founded in 1951, is a classical ballet repertory company that presents a very wide range of choreography, from the 19thcentury classics and masterworks by later choreographers to newly commissioned ballets.
